Commit graph

389 commits

Author SHA1 Message Date
github-actions[bot]
7dab9962ad flake.lock: Update
Flake lock file updates:

• Updated input 'nixos-2305':
    'github:NixOS/nixpkgs/9faf91e6d0b7743d41cce3b63a8e5c733dc696a3' (2023-11-20)
  → 'github:NixOS/nixpkgs/ee5ddacfab29812b32b5ea8c1dacdadfdf264475' (2023-11-22)
• Updated input 'nixos-unstable':
    'github:NixOS/nixpkgs/12a0ade5e458984675b9789a4b260ebabdd2d1ab' (2023-11-19)
  → 'github:NixOS/nixpkgs/da41de71f62bf7fb989a04e39629b8adbf8aa8b5' (2023-11-22)
2023-11-23 00:53:16 +00:00
mergify[bot]
fc531304e2
Merge pull request #144 from nix-community/machine-id
also copy machine-id into installer
2023-11-22 13:45:28 +00:00
Jörg Thalheim
bebc30e7fd also copy machine-id into installer
This can help with keeping the same dhcp leases when the dhcp server uses DUID rather than mac addresses
2023-11-22 10:45:18 +01:00
mergify[bot]
6531732454
Merge pull request #143 from nix-community/joerg-ci
flake.nix: switch back to nixos-unstable-small upstream
2023-11-20 11:40:50 +00:00
Jörg Thalheim
6688a9b437 flake.nix: switch back to nixos-unstable-small upstream 2023-11-20 12:23:12 +01:00
Jörg Thalheim
4dcc041b86
Merge pull request #142 from nix-community/sane-nix-settings
add nix-settings from srvos
2023-11-20 12:15:23 +01:00
Jörg Thalheim
971b6849d5 add nix-settings from srvos
if used as a recovery system, it's useful to have flakes etc enabled.
2023-11-19 13:23:43 +01:00
mergify[bot]
b75f16f72f
Merge pull request #141 from nix-community/joerg-ci
add comment for lvm raid
2023-11-12 11:39:30 +00:00
Jörg Thalheim
c0a2c19f83 add comment for lvm raid 2023-11-12 12:34:58 +01:00
Jörg Thalheim
092b60439f
Merge pull request #140 from nix-community/add-dm-raid
load dm-raid kernel module
2023-11-12 12:33:28 +01:00
zimbatm
a8fbf192c7 load dm-raid kernel module
Fixes https://github.com/nix-community/nixos-anywhere/issues/249
2023-11-12 11:43:01 +01:00
Jörg Thalheim
81ab4e8f6f
Merge pull request #139 from nbdd0121/patch-1
Copy ecdsa/sk keys from /root/.ssh/authorized_keys
2023-11-08 23:18:30 +01:00
Gary Guo
7d89d7c99f
Copy ecdsa/sk keys from /root/.ssh/authorized_keys 2023-11-08 16:13:10 +00:00
mergify[bot]
fca6d15d05
Merge pull request #138 from nix-community/joerg-ci
reduce test in VM to 1.2 GB RAM
2023-11-02 12:08:31 +00:00
mergify[bot]
28250ff73f
Merge branch 'main' into joerg-ci 2023-11-02 12:02:27 +00:00
Jörg Thalheim
1afdae78b7 reduce test in VM to 1.2 GB RAM 2023-11-02 13:01:36 +01:00
Jörg Thalheim
25f4c4dddd
Merge pull request #137 from nix-community/nixpkgs-upstream
no longer delete existing assets
2023-11-02 12:44:58 +01:00
Jörg Thalheim
6c43b7016d no longer delete existing assets
we now have both aarch64/x86_64 overwriting each other
2023-11-02 12:42:50 +01:00
mergify[bot]
233cb26594
Merge pull request #136 from nix-community/nixpkgs-upstream
kexec-installer: disable channel in unstable
2023-11-02 10:41:23 +00:00
Jörg Thalheim
913fba8fbe netboot-installer: disable channel in unstable 2023-11-02 11:09:57 +01:00
Jörg Thalheim
6b3ebfbf99 kexec-installer: disable channel in unstable 2023-11-02 11:09:57 +01:00
mergify[bot]
dd2e96b4a4
Merge pull request #135 from nix-community/nixpkgs-upstream
switch back to nixpkgs upstream
2023-11-02 09:54:17 +00:00
Jörg Thalheim
fba4a2bf0d apply nixpkgs-fmt 2023-11-02 10:43:57 +01:00
Jörg Thalheim
75d7180dc1 netboot-installer: also enable ipv6 router advertisment 2023-11-02 10:43:21 +01:00
Jörg Thalheim
8239d6079a no longer depend on dhcpcd for dhcp networking 2023-11-02 10:43:08 +01:00
Jörg Thalheim
8f0b2d8f63 drop checksum from release tab
it no longer works since we have now two architectures build independently
2023-11-02 08:54:22 +01:00
Jörg Thalheim
8eb1ef49d5 switch to nixos-unstable-small
flake.lock: Update

Flake lock file updates:

• Updated input 'nixos-2305':
    'github:NixOS/nixpkgs/f9d25531cc073c6ae78c6988e12455eb1e015134' (2023-11-01)
  → 'github:NixOS/nixpkgs/ecd985f22e007e6ac3152d68590c06cbbaea8c0e' (2023-11-02)
2023-11-02 08:54:22 +01:00
Jörg Thalheim
d84d1b296b installer: useNetworkd consistently 2023-10-28 16:11:35 +02:00
Jörg Thalheim
dc68643995 switch back to nixpkgs upstream 2023-10-28 15:58:39 +02:00
mergify[bot]
87bccdbdfb
Merge pull request #134 from Stunkymonkey/fix-typos
fix some typos
2023-10-17 03:59:56 +00:00
Felix Buehler
e62ab61f81 fix some typos 2023-10-16 23:22:54 +02:00
mergify[bot]
c4c73bce65
Merge pull request #132 from nix-community/dependabot/github_actions/actions/checkout-4
build(deps): bump actions/checkout from 3 to 4
2023-09-11 10:54:47 +00:00
dependabot[bot]
23851e1ff0
build(deps): bump actions/checkout from 3 to 4
Bumps [actions/checkout](https://github.com/actions/checkout) from 3 to 4.
- [Release notes](https://github.com/actions/checkout/releases)
- [Changelog](https://github.com/actions/checkout/blob/main/CHANGELOG.md)
- [Commits](https://github.com/actions/checkout/compare/v3...v4)

---
updated-dependencies:
- dependency-name: actions/checkout
  dependency-type: direct:production
  update-type: version-update:semver-major
...

Signed-off-by: dependabot[bot] <support@github.com>
2023-09-11 10:45:27 +00:00
mergify[bot]
cfae37e520
Merge pull request #131 from nix-community/dependabot/github_actions/cachix/install-nix-action-23
build(deps): bump cachix/install-nix-action from 22 to 23
2023-09-04 11:00:50 +00:00
dependabot[bot]
4e62ea7677
build(deps): bump cachix/install-nix-action from 22 to 23
Bumps [cachix/install-nix-action](https://github.com/cachix/install-nix-action) from 22 to 23.
- [Release notes](https://github.com/cachix/install-nix-action/releases)
- [Commits](https://github.com/cachix/install-nix-action/compare/v22...v23)

---
updated-dependencies:
- dependency-name: cachix/install-nix-action
  dependency-type: direct:production
  update-type: version-update:semver-major
...

Signed-off-by: dependabot[bot] <support@github.com>
2023-09-04 10:40:54 +00:00
mergify[bot]
8cddbac8c6
Merge pull request #130 from nix-community/dependabot/github_actions/DeterminateSystems/update-flake-lock-20
build(deps): bump DeterminateSystems/update-flake-lock from 19 to 20
2023-08-28 10:39:16 +00:00
dependabot[bot]
a8e011a556
build(deps): bump DeterminateSystems/update-flake-lock from 19 to 20
Bumps [DeterminateSystems/update-flake-lock](https://github.com/determinatesystems/update-flake-lock) from 19 to 20.
- [Release notes](https://github.com/determinatesystems/update-flake-lock/releases)
- [Commits](https://github.com/determinatesystems/update-flake-lock/compare/v19...v20)

---
updated-dependencies:
- dependency-name: DeterminateSystems/update-flake-lock
  dependency-type: direct:production
  update-type: version-update:semver-major
...

Signed-off-by: dependabot[bot] <support@github.com>
2023-08-28 10:28:31 +00:00
mergify[bot]
32c29d4ec7
Merge pull request #129 from nix-community/kexec-auto
kexec-installer: re-enable kexec-syscall-auto
2023-08-26 18:22:53 +00:00
Jörg Thalheim
f11fd49c78 kexec-installer: re-enable kexec-syscall-auto
Seems like GCP changed something about their boot process and the same instance types that failed to kexec, now just works.
This fixes secureboot as well: https://github.com/nix-community/nixos-images/issues/128
2023-08-26 19:36:51 +02:00
Jörg Thalheim
3067fe0c60
Merge pull request #127 from nix-community/ci
flake.lock: Update
2023-08-05 06:49:46 +01:00
Jörg Thalheim
f715155f87 flake.lock: Update
Flake lock file updates:

• Updated input 'nixos-2305':
    'github:NixOS/nixpkgs/9652a97d9738d3e65cf33c0bc24429e495a7868f' (2023-08-04)
  → 'github:Mic92/nixpkgs/831724726ba052189092f52ae0774dd406d657bb' (2023-08-05)
2023-08-05 07:49:32 +02:00
Jörg Thalheim
74ca72e242
Merge pull request #126 from nix-community/ci
also fix netboot on release-23.05
2023-08-05 06:48:15 +01:00
mergify[bot]
2a98397eb4
Merge branch 'main' into ci 2023-08-05 05:46:50 +00:00
Jörg Thalheim
377e275ebc also fix netboot on release-23.05 2023-08-05 07:45:36 +02:00
Jörg Thalheim
8cfcde285d
Merge pull request #125 from nix-community/ci
fix kernel name
2023-08-04 22:40:11 +01:00
Jörg Thalheim
a1478fe225 fix kernel name 2023-08-04 23:40:01 +02:00
Jörg Thalheim
1361e3e22a
Merge pull request #124 from nix-community/ci
ci: improve updating assets
2023-08-04 21:56:02 +01:00
mergify[bot]
4fd1a924cb
Merge branch 'main' into ci 2023-08-04 20:52:28 +00:00
Jörg Thalheim
3b4624dc1a build-images: reformat with shellfmt 2023-08-04 22:51:45 +02:00
Jörg Thalheim
7066549ee6 update assets more atomically 2023-08-04 22:51:45 +02:00